gpt4 book ai didi

java - 在java 1.7项目中使用java 1.8项目的依赖

转载 作者:行者123 更新时间:2023-12-02 04:46:11 26 4
gpt4 key购买 nike

我有一个基于 java 7 的 Maven 项目,比如 A。我有另一个基于 java 8 的外部 Maven 项目,比如 B。

是否可以在项目A中添加项目B的依赖?

最佳答案

这是不可能的,因为项目 B 中的类(使用 Java 8 编译时)将具有不同的类格式。结果将是某种类型的类格式错误 like here .

如果项目 B 使用目标 1.7 进行编译,并且不使用 Java 8 中的 API,那么它可能会工作。

最安全的做法是假设您在使用项目 B 时必须使用 Java 8。

关于java - 在java 1.7项目中使用java 1.8项目的依赖,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29644211/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com